*{ margin:0; padding:0;}
body {
  font-family:'',arial,serif,sans-serif;
  background: #fff url(../images/bg.jpg) repeat-x;}
a,a:hover { text-decoration:none;}
ul,ul li { list-style: none;}
img { max-width: 100%; border: 0;}

.w1000{ width: 1000px; margin: 0 auto; min-width: 1000px;}

.header {width: 1000px; font-size: 14px; text-align: left;color: #fff; margin: 0 auto; background: url(../images/headerbg.jpg) no-repeat center top; overflow: hidden; height: 171px; padding: 5px 0 0 0;}
.header img {  margin: 10px 0 0 0; width: 645px; float:left;}
.srchwrap { float: right;}
.srchwrap input[type="text"] { padding: 0 0 0 5px; outline: none; border: 1px solid #f8ad52;color: #333; background-color: rgba(255,255,255,0.6); width: 160px; height: 20px; float: left;}
.srchwrap input[type="image"] {  color: #109ace; width: 50px; height: 22px;float: left;}
#theClock { float: left; font-size:12px;}


#times { color: #fff; float: left; font-size: 12px;}
/****/
.top-search { overflow: hidden; float: right; margin: 2px 0 0 15px; width: 210px;}
.top-search input[type="text"] { height: 22px; line-height: 22px; color: #fff; float: left; width: 150px; border: 1px solid #ccc; background: none;}
.top-search input[type="button"] { letter-spacing:3px;height: 24px; line-height: 24px; background-color: #0b81c6; float: left; width: 50px; color: #fff; border: 0;}

.nav { background: url(../images/navbg.jpg) no-repeat center top; width: 1100px; margin:0 auto; height: 69px;}
.listConPad { padding:5px 5px 0 5px;}
.nav ul {
  width: 1000px;
    margin: 0 auto;
z-index:100;}
.nav ul li {
	float: left;
	width: 138px;
	font-size: 16px;
	text-align: center;
	height: 52px;
	line-height: 52px;
	font-weight: bold;
	position: relative;
z-index:100;}

.nav ul  li>a { color: #fff;}
.nav  ul >li:hover{ background: #fff;}
.nav  ul >li:hover >a { color:#333;}
.nav ul li >div {display: none;  width: 166px; background-color: #0b81c6; position: absolute ; z-index: 50; top: 49px; left: 0px; font-size: 14px;}
.nav ul li >div > a { font-weight: normal; color:#fff;border-top: 1px solid #89c0e7; height: 35px; line-height: 35px; display: block; font-family: '';}
.nav  ul li >div > a:hover { background-color: #fff; color: #0b81c6;}
.nav  ul >li:hover > div { display: block;}

.w300 {
	width: 320px;height: 236px;float: left; overflow: hidden;}

	.mar { margin: 0 0 0 20px;}
.leftImgText { width:320px; height: 240px; overflow:hidden; position:relative;}
.leftImgText .hd{ height:23px; overflow:hidden; position:absolute; right:5px; bottom:0px; z-index:1;}
.leftImgText .hd ul{ overflow:hidden; zoom:1; float:left; height: 30px;}
.leftImgText .hd ul li{ font-size: 12px; float:left; margin-right:3px;  width:15px; 
height:15px; line-height:17px; text-align:center; border:1px solid #fff; background:#959494;cursor:pointer; color: #fff;}
.leftImgText .hd ul li.on{ background:#f00; color:#fff;}
.leftImgText .bd{ position:relative; height:100%; z-index:0;}
.leftImgText .bd li { zoom:1; vertical-align:middle; font-size: 13px;}
.leftImgText .bd li >span { display: block; overflow:hidden;width:320px ;height: 240px;}
.leftImgText .bd li >a {padding: 0 10px;  height: 30px; line-height: 30px; text-align: left; display: block; width: 100%; background: url(../images/left_box_bg.jpg) repeat-x left bottom; position: absolute; left: 0; bottom:0; color: #fff;}
.leftImgText .bd li img { width:320px ;height: 240px;}



.title1 {
  width: 100%;
  height: 30px;
  line-height: 30px;
  background: url(../images/tibg3.jpg) repeat-x left bottom;
  border-top:1px solid #dfdfdf;
  
  border-bottom: 2px solid #0b81c6;}
.title1 span {
	 display: inline-block; color: #fff;
  font-size: 14px;
  font-weight: bold;
  height: 30px;
  padding: 0 20px;
  float: left;
  background: url(../images/tibg.jpg) repeat-x left 1px;
  letter-spacing: 2px;}
.title1 >b {display: inline-block; float: left; background: url(../images/tibg2.jpg) no-repeat left 1px; height: 30px; width: 9px;}
.title1 a {
  font-size: 12px;
  color: #333;
  line-height: 30px;
  float: right;
  font-weight: normal;
  padding: 0 5px 0 0;
  margin: 0 1px 0  0;
  font-family: "sans-serif";
   border-right:1px solid #dfdfdf;}

.con_ul_list { padding: 5px 10px 0 10px;}

.con_list_warp,.con_ul_list{overflow: hidden;}
.con_list_warp  { padding: 10px 10px 0 10px;}
.con_ul_list li { background: url(../images/list.jpg) no-repeat left center; padding: 0 0 0 10px; font-size: 13px; height: 32px; line-height: 32px; border-bottom: 1px dotted #999999;}
.con_ul_list li >a { color: #333;}
.con_ul_list li >a:hover {  color: #c11a21;}

.con3-div3-ul {
  width: 100%;
  height: 80px;
  margin: 18px 0 7px 0;}
.con3-div3-ul a { margin:0px 0 10px 10px; color: #333; font-size: 12px; width: 80px; padding: 0 0 0 20px; display: inline-block; background: url(../images/rss.jpg) no-repeat left center;}
.con3-div3-ul a:hover { text-decoration: underline; color: #c11a21;}


.footer {font-size:12px; text-align: center; width: 1000px; margin: 0 auto; clear: both; border-top:3px solid #0b81c6;  padding: 15px 0; color: #333;}


 { clear: both; overflow: hidden; padding:15px  0px;}
.aboutLink a {text-align: left;  color:#333; font-size: 14px; display: inline-block;  width: 184px;  margin: 10px 0px 10px 10px;}
.aboutLink a:hover { text-decoration: underline;color: #c11a21;}

.w500 { width:320px;}
.shixun { float: right;}
.newImg { float:left;}
.notice { float: right;}

.con_list_title { height: 40px; line-height: 40px; border-bottom: 2px dotted #0a7bc5; background:url(../images/nav.jpg) no-repeat 15px center; padding:0 0 0 30px;}
.list_con_contenet { overflow: hidden; padding: 10px; min-height: 300px;}
.list_con_contenet p { border-bottom: 1px solid #eee;}